Community Health Challenges

The Unique Pressures Community Health Faces

Primary care and community health services operate under fundamentally different constraints to hospitals and aged care, your staffing solutions need to reflect that.

Location Barrier

Qualified nurses don't want to relocate to regional or remote areas. Your town can't compete with metro lifestyle, and agencies don't service locations this far out.

Chronic Understaffing

You've had vacancies open for months. Existing staff are covering multiple roles and burning out. Service delivery capacity is shrinking while community demand grows.

Cultural Safety Requirements

Aboriginal Health Services and diverse communities require staff who understand culturally safe practice, not just clinical competence. Generic agencies don't train for this.

Budget Constraints

Community health funding doesn't stretch to metro agency rates. You need quality staff at prices that work within government-funded service delivery budgets.

Community Integration

Staff who don't understand small-town dynamics or community health models leave quickly. You need people who will settle, integrate and stay.

Multi-Role Expectations

Community health nurses wear many hats, clinical care, health promotion, chronic disease management, home visits. You need generalists with broad competence.

Retention & Settlement

We Don't Just Place Staff - We Help Them Settle

The biggest reason regional community health workers leave is isolation, not the job itself. Our pastoral care model addresses this directly. We support deployed staff with housing guidance, community integration, social connection and ongoing welfare check-ins so they build a life in your community, not just a work roster.

Retention is our primary focus, not just placement. We provide pre-arrival community orientation, housing and transport guidance, introduction to local social networks, regular welfare check-ins and career development support. Our pastoral care model continues for the first 12 months and beyond. Staff who feel supported and connected to their community stay longer. Our retention rates in regional placements significantly exceed industry benchmarks.
Community health services typically benefit most from longer-term contracted arrangements, 6 or 12 months, rather than casual pools, because continuity of care and community relationships matter more in primary care settings. We also offer recruitment fulfilment for permanent positions. We'll discuss the best model for your situation during the initial consultation.
